bacon ice cream has nothing on the foie gras version of the sweet treat at london newcomer hibiscus, opening wednesday.
we love our foie with toast points and grilled pears. ice cream, we're not so sure. but if the michelin-starred resto's rep precedes it, we'll take our chances. hibiscus is moving from its original location in gastronomic-rich ludlow to london and bringing the entire staff, in hopes of making a seamless transition. we hope so too. head chef claude bosi and wife claire will continue to whip up snails in garlic and lime foam, carpaccio of cornish cod and irish sea urchin. bosi's inventive daily menu shows his time in the top paris kitchens (under alain ducasse) and his obvious love of the job. throw in a 700-bin wine list and subversive-sounding sweets like iced olive oil parfait in a newly-designed spot, and it'll be one to watch. be prepared to come in with an iron stomach for hibiscus' inventive combos.
we just hope carmelized pig's head terrine is your thing.
